I was thinking about powder coating but was advised against it, I want black rims as well but have decided on waiting until the budget allows me to splurge on aftermarket black rims. What is the difference between painting and powder coating and should I consider powdercoating again?
closer9 12-13-2007, 08:52 AM IMHO, I would powder over paint. Its much more durable. I powder coated the wheels on my trailer among MANY other items on the Belvedere in my sig, and some on the Camino in my sig. My dad has powder coated wheels on his Sprint, and I believe there is at least one member on here with PC wheels.
Powder coat is simply a very fine plastic powder that is electrolytically sprayed on metal, then heated to around 350-400 F to melt or cure (depending on the type of powder). They say when done right you should be able to drop a 1 lb weight from 1 foot and not chip the coating...
Why were you advised against it??? I am a big proponent of powder coating and have been doing it myself with an Eastwood's kit for a couple years or so...

A fellow EOCer had it done and he said that it was cheap and durable but then another E owner told me he either did it once or knew someone who had it done and the rims chipped pretty quickly.
How would I determine if a company does good work and what's a good price for all four wheels?
closer9 12-14-2007, 09:19 AM Best bet is like any other shop, try to get some references. Ask around, etc...
I've never paid to have any wheels coated, but Dad paid $50 a wheel for (4) 15"X7"s and (4) 15"x8"s... and I think most would agree that's about average maybe a little on the low end for most places...
Def. go with powder coat. Friend painted his wheels and they looked like cr@p after only a few months. Paint just won't stand up to use, chips right off.
TheAntirice 12-14-2007, 06:29 PM Ive painted some wheels before with Duplicolor wheel paint with great results. Black is hard to find but they sell it like base/clear if you just lightly sand the surface and make sure its clean before painting you can get oem like finish. NOt everybody is so inclined to do such a thing but it can be done fairly cheap. The paint is about 7$ a can (if you can find it)
